Syntozyga ephippias is a tortrix moth (family Tortricidae), belonging to tribe Eucosmini of subfamily Olethreutinae.
The species was first described by Edward Meyrick in 1907.
It is found Sri Lanka,[1] India,[2] the Democratic Republic of the Congo, South Africa and Rodrigues.
[3] Larval food plants are Commelina benghalensis (Commelinaceae)[4] and Bambusa species.
